LM00BR85 Rural Entrepreneurship (4 cr)
Prerequisites Not applicable
Objectives Student is familiar with common branches of rural entrepreneurship and is able to assess their economic preconditions. Student recognizes opportunities for rural networks and specialization. Student is acquainted with rural subsidy system and options for public funding. Student is able to scan, recognize and evaluate business opportunities and utilize business support networks. Student explores entrepreneurship as a personal career.
Content Branches of rural business and estimating their preconditions
Business networks and specialization
Rural subsidy system
Entrepreneurship and its importance in society
Business models
Business development process
Characteristics of an entrepreneur
Support networks of entrepreneurship and key stakeholders
Support of OUAS for new venture creation
